Two-day summer festival of the Klausen- und Traditionsverein in the Türkheim castle gardens, district of Unterallgäu
Türkheim — a market town with about 8,000 inhabitants in the district of Unterallgäu — boasts a neoclassical castle, the former summer residence of the Welfs, and its extensive castle gardens. This area is the venue for several events throughout the year, including the Schlossgartenfest organized by the Klausen- und Traditionsverein Türkheim e.V.
The festival is designed as a two-evening event: On Friday, July 31, 2026, a DJ will provide the musical entertainment from 7:00 PM onwards — a typical Schlossgartenfest mix of Schlager, party hits, and current charts. On Saturday, August 1, 2026, a live band will play from 6:00 PM onwards. As with many club festivals in Unterallgäu, the atmosphere is more relaxed and danceable than folkloric and traditional.
The organizer is the Klausen- und Traditionsverein Türkheim e.V., one of the town's traditional clubs. Klausenvereine (tradition clubs) preserve the customs surrounding the St. Nicholas and Klaus tradition in the Upper Swabian-Allgäu region — the Klausen procession on St. Nicholas Day is an important date in Türkheim. Stemming from this club tradition, the association organizes the Schlossgartenfest as a summer counterpart to the winter Klausen customs.
The market town of Türkheim is located about 15 kilometers northwest of Bad Wörishofen and is easily accessible via the A96 motorway. Its location between the Mindel and Wertach rivers in the gentle foothills of the Allgäu Alps makes it a relaxed summer destination; the Schlossgartenfest benefits from long, often warm summer evenings and the peaceful atmosphere of the historic grounds.
As is customary at Bavarian club festivals, the Klausen- und Traditionsverein handles the catering themselves: drinks from the beer stand, food from the grill, and snacks. The atmosphere in the castle gardens is summery and relaxed, with tables set up outdoors.

The names of the DJ and the live band for 2026 will be announced by the Klausen- und Traditionsverein Türkheim e.V. shortly before the festival on the events page of the market town of Türkheim.
Free admission. Food and drinks at club-standard prices — beer approx. €4–5, schnitzel/bratwurst €8–12. Proceeds benefit the club's activities.
By car via the A96 (exit Bad Wörishofen or Buchloe), a few minutes to Türkheim. By train: Türkheim (Bay) station on the Augsburg–Buchloe–Memmingen line.
Schloßgarten Türkheim — reachable on foot from the market square.
